Who we are?
Asociația pentru Integrare și Dezvoltare Comunitară is a non-governmental, non-political and non-profit organization, established under Government Ordinance (O.G.) no. 26 of 30.01.2000. The association works for the benefit of young people and their families. The association obtained legal personality in May 2004.
Our vision
To become a professional and competitive organization that can efficiently respond to the real needs of its beneficiaries.
Our mission
To develop integration projects for young people in the local community and to provide training services that complement what already exists in the formal education system.
Our objectives
- development of income-generating activities based on knowledge acquired through special vocational training programs.
- implementation and development of a new attitude towards the needs and opportunities of Romanian society;
- creation of non-formal educational programs for youth in order to support young people with creative potential;
- creation of specialization / upskilling programs for young people in diverse professional fields;
